Battery Holders, Clips, Contacts

1. Overview

Battery holders, clips, and contacts are electromechanical components designed to securely mount batteries in electronic devices while ensuring reliable electrical connectivity. These components play critical roles in power delivery systems, enabling safe and efficient operation across industries. Their importance has grown with the proliferation of portable electronics, IoT devices, and renewable energy systems.

3. Structure and Components

Typical construction includes: - Insulating housing (ABS/PVC/nylon) - Conductive elements (phosphor bronze, beryllium copper) - Contact plating (gold, nickel, tin) - Mechanical retention features (snap tabs, screw terminals) - Polarization guides (molded keying features)

4. Key Technical Specifications

ParameterImportance
Rated Current (0.5-5A)Determines maximum power capacity
Contact Resistance (5-50m )Affects energy efficiency and heat generation
Insulation Resistance (>100M )Critical for electrical safety
Operating Temperature (-20 C to +85 C)Defines environmental compatibility
Insertion Force (0.1-2N)Impacts user experience and durability

7. Selection Recommendations

Key considerations: - Battery chemistry compatibility (alkaline/Li-ion) - Current/voltage requirements - Environmental conditions (temperature/humidity) - Mechanical mounting requirements - Agency certifications (UL, RoHS)
